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06534024686 47525578 22 9650 8250
18746628023 872934352 952588668
18746628023 872934352 952588668
4563380 2004 147010 0288
All about undefined
Interested in learning more?
18746628023 872934352 952588668
4563380 2004 147010 0288
See more
61897966 09 557115
82 0869179 960 1147054203
See more
01401 90593
6080776637 6720 67404
See more